      Wordpress Developer Interview

      Aug 21, 2018
      Anonymous Interview Candidate
      Toronto, ON
      Declined offer
      Negative experience
      Easy interview

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at KoreConX (Toronto, ON) in May 2018

      Interview

      What a joke. First and foremost, the screening email they initially sent me was absolutely riddled with grammatical and spelling errors. Immediate turn off. Upon checking the reviews on their facebook page, it is extremely obvious that all of the positive reviews are fake accounts, presumably set up by Oscar. My main issue with this company, however, is their ridiculous notion that unpaid work is somehow still acceptable as it adds 'experience' to one's resume. Newsflash: my first job in Toronto fresh out of school paid a total compensation of $62,000 a year. Plenty of companies in the bay area readily pay new grads >= $100,000, experience or not. So, to everyone reading this that is new to the software development job market, please know that there are plenty of of jobs out there that will pay a decent salary regardless of lack of experience. You do not have to settle working for scumbags like this and are worth so much more. Please also consider the fact that this company has been operating for a few years and still hasn't managed to raise a dime. Pathetic. There guys are clowns, and hopefully have misrepresented enough people during the hiring process that would allow a suit to be filed against them.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      What plugins are you familiar with in WP, ie SEO, Newsletter, etc...
